I have been trying different ways to start explorer.exe from Emacs on w32. I can not find any way that works. It is a quite annoying bug.

Did you try w32-shell-execute?


Thanks, I thought I did, but I should have tried more. For example

   (w32-shell-execute "open" ".")

just gives "ShellExecute failed: No application is associated with the specified file for this operation". But trying again I see that

  (w32-shell-execute "open" default-directory)

actually starts explorer.exe.

So now I can define these to integrate more with w32:

(defun w32-explorer(dir)
  "Open Windows Explorer in directory DIR."
  (interactive "DStart in directory: ")
  (setq dir (expand-file-name dir))
  (w32-shell-execute "open" dir))

(defun w32-cmd(dir)
  "Open a Windows command prompt in directory DIR."
  (interactive "DStart in directory: ")
  (let ((default-directory (expand-file-name dir)))
    (call-process "cmd.exe" nil 0 nil "/c" "start")))
